Jupiter in the 9th House
Modern
Meaning, travel, philosophy, faith, and higher learning are your richest soil for growth, and this is one of Jupiter's happiest homes. You are built to expand your world and to find and share something to believe in, often as a natural teacher or perpetual student. The work is staying open rather than preachy, and living wisdom as well as seeking it. At your best you give others back their sense of meaning and possibility.
Traditional (Hellenistic)
The ninth is the cadent place the tradition calls God, governing travel, philosophy, religion, and higher learning. Jupiter, lord of the ninth sign, is profoundly at home here: a deep faith, a philosophical and far-seeing mind, fortune through travel, foreigners, and higher study, often the teacher or the believer. Brennan reads the ninth as the place of the divine and the sojourn abroad. The gift is wisdom, faith, and a wide-open world; the cost is dogmatism, preaching, and a restlessness that is always elsewhere.
